Android 16 stable comes to Pixel devices

As expected, Google rolled out the first stable release of Android 16 for its Pixel lineup. The update is now available to Pixel 6 series and newer phones as well as the Pixel Tablet. Android 16 stable is available as an OTA update for the following devices.

Two of Android 16’s biggest changes are not part of this first stable release. We’re talking about Material 3 Expressive and the new Desktop mode, which will arrive later.

Google also released its developer-focused Android 16 QPR 2 beta, which includes the new Desktop mode. It requires a DisplayPort connection to the external monitor and allows users to run multiple apps with resizable windows. There’s a taskbar that shows running apps and an app drawer.

Connected phones operate independently from the external display. If you’re using a tablet like Google’s very own Pixel Tablet, the desktop session will be extended across both displays so you can drag items across both the tablet screen and the connected display.

Android 16 stable brings support for adaptive apps, which ensure apps scale and behave properly regardless of your phone’s screen size, orientation or form factor. This should be a big boost for foldables.

Notifications from a single app will now be grouped to reduce clutter.

Google is also overhauling its notification management with Live updates – dynamic notifications for ongoing activities like navigation, ride-hailing, and food delivery. These types of notifications will be available on your lock screen and in the system status area.

Users with hearing aids will get a new native control toggle which brings battery status, presets, microphone selection and volume control. Users can now switch to using their phone’s microphone for better voice pickup in noisier environments.

Advanced Protection allows users to protect their personal data from online attacks, harmful apps, unsafe websites, and scam calls.

Tablets are getting a new desktop windowing option. This feature allows users to open, move and resize multiple app windows in a desktop-like interface. This feature will roll out later this year on compatible devices.

Other features in Android 16 stable include custom keyboard shortcuts, HDR screenshots, adaptive refresh rate controls, and identity check.
